SOLVER_MAX_ITERATIONS (default 5000) bounds runtime; raise only for the Ashcombe Academy dataset. SOLVER_SEED fixes randomization for reproducible runs. HARD_CONSTRAINT_MODE=strict rejects any schedule with room clashes; lenient logs and continues. TIMETABLE_CACHE_TTL controls how long solved grids persist between term edits. Do not set SOLVER_THREADS above physical cores; the annealer degrades badly. The solver posts results to the publishing gateway and authenticates with a token the env file sets on the next line.

vault entry, yajop-bafop: ARCHIVE_KEY3=8d4

## Further reading

The reconciliation job compares warehouse counts from Stockline against ledger entries in Tallyroot every six hours. Discrepancies above the tolerance threshold are written to the `recon_deltas` table and flagged for manual review. Reviewers should understand the idempotency guarantees before approving changes to the matching logic, since partial runs are resumed rather than restarted. A full design document, including the matching algorithm and known edge cases, is available at the following internal page.

runbook for badug-kadup: https://confluence.zemvarlabs.internal/projects/browse/display/projects/bd1b

Snapshot tests for the Quillbird component library run under `quill-snap`. From a security standpoint: snapshots are committed to the repo, so any rendered secrets would persist in history — the sanitizer strips known token patterns before serialization. Diff tolerance, render timeout, and retry counts are all configurable; loosening them widens the window for masked regressions, so review any change here carefully. The defaults enforced in CI are as follows.

tuning constants:
RATE_LIMITS = {
    "goriel": 284,
    "brieth": 236,
    "lamvan": 916,
    "druok": 255,
    "wenion": 979,
    "istmir": 343,
    "queniel": 302,
}